package mm_network;
use strict;
use warnings;
use base 'Exporter';
use Exporter;
use testapi;
use version_utils 'is_opensuse';
use Utils::Architectures 'is_aarch64';
our @EXPORT = qw(configure_hostname get_host_resolv_conf is_networkmanager restart_networking
configure_static_ip configure_dhcp configure_default_gateway configure_static_dns
parse_network_configuration ip_in_subnet check_ip_in_subnet setup_static_mm_network);
sub configure_hostname {
my ($hostname) = @_;
if (get_var('VERSION') =~ /^11/) {
enter_cmd "echo '$hostname' > /etc/HOSTNAME";
enter_cmd "echo '$hostname' > /etc/hostname";
enter_cmd "hostname '$hostname'";
}
else {
enter_cmd "hostnamectl set-hostname '$hostname'";
}
}
sub get_host_resolv_conf {
my %conf;
open(my $fh, '<', "/etc/resolv.conf");
while (my $line = <$fh>) {
if ($line =~ /^nameserver\s+([0-9.]+)\s*$/) {
$conf{nameserver} //= [];
diag('mm_network::get_host_resolv_conf nameserver ' . $1);
push @{$conf{nameserver}}, $1;
}
if ($line =~ /search\s+(.+)\s*$/) {
diag('mm_network::get_host_resolv_conf search ' . $1);
$conf{search} = $1;
}
}
if (scalar @{$conf{nameserver}} == 0) {
# If we don't get the name server from openQA worker we try to use the worker IP address
push(@{$conf{nameserver}}, script_output("ip route show | awk '/default/ { print \$3 }'"));
}
close($fh);
return \%conf;
}
sub is_networkmanager {
my $is_nm = (script_run('readlink /etc/systemd/system/network.service | grep NetworkManager') == 0);
record_info('NetworkManager', (($is_nm) ? 'NetworkManager has been detected.' : 'NetworkManager has not been detected.'));
return $is_nm;
}
sub configure_static_ip {
my (%args) = @_;
my $ip = $args{ip};
my $mtu = $args{mtu} // get_var('MM_MTU', 1380);
my $is_nm = $args{is_nm} // is_networkmanager();
my $device = $args{device};
if ($is_nm) {
my $nm_id;
$device //= '\S';
my $nm_list = script_output("nmcli -t -f DEVICE,NAME c | grep -v '^lo:' | grep -e '$device' | head -n1");
($device, $nm_id) = split(':', $nm_list);
record_info('set_ip', "Device: $device\n NM ID: $nm_id\nIP: $ip\nMTU: $mtu");
assert_script_run "nmcli connection modify '$nm_id' ifname '$device' ip4 $ip ipv4.method manual 802-3-ethernet.mtu $mtu";
} else {
# Get MAC address
my $net_conf = parse_network_configuration();
my $mac = $net_conf->{fixed}->{mac};
# Get default network adapter name
$device ||= script_output("grep $mac /sys/class/net/*/address |cut -d / -f 5");
record_info('set_ip', "Device: $device\nIP: $ip\nMTU: $mtu");
# check for duplicate IP
my ($ip_no_mask, $mask) = split('/', $ip);
script_run "arping -w 1 -I $device $ip_no_mask";
# Configure the static networking
assert_script_run "echo -e \"STARTMODE='auto'\\nBOOTPROTO='static'\\nIPADDR='$ip'\\nMTU='$mtu'\" > /etc/sysconfig/network/ifcfg-$device";
}
}
sub configure_dhcp {
my $net_conf = parse_network_configuration();
my @mac;
for my $net (values %$net_conf) {
push @mac, $net->{mac} if $net->{dhcp};
}
type_string "for MAC in " . join(' ', @mac) . " ; do ";
type_string "NIC=`grep \$MAC /sys/class/net/*/address |cut -d / -f 5`;";
type_string("echo \"STARTMODE='auto'\nBOOTPROTO='dhcp'\n\" > /etc/sysconfig/network/ifcfg-\$NIC;");
enter_cmd 'done';
save_screenshot;
assert_script_run "rcnetwork restart";
assert_script_run "ip addr";
save_screenshot;
}
sub configure_default_gateway {
my (%args) = @_;
my $is_nm = $args{is_nm} // is_networkmanager();
my $device = $args{device} // '\S';
if ($is_nm) {
my $nm_id;
# When $device is not specified grep just does nothing and first connection is selected
my $nm_list = script_output("nmcli -t -f DEVICE,NAME c | grep -v '^lo:' | grep -e '$device' | head -n1");
($device, $nm_id) = split(':', $nm_list);
assert_script_run "nmcli connection modify '$nm_id' ipv4.gateway 10.0.2.2";
} else {
enter_cmd("echo 'default 10.0.2.2 - -' > /etc/sysconfig/network/routes");
}
}
sub configure_static_dns {
my ($conf, %args) = @_;
my $is_nm = $args{is_nm} // is_networkmanager();
my $nm_id = $args{nm_id};
my $silent = $args{silent} // 0;
my $servers = join(" ", @{$conf->{nameserver}});
if ($is_nm) {
$nm_id = script_output("nmcli -t -f NAME c | grep -v '^lo' | head -n 1") unless ($nm_id);
assert_script_run "nmcli connection modify '$nm_id' ipv4.dns '$servers'";
} else {
assert_script_run("sync", timeout => 600) if is_aarch64; # workaround for slow virtual disk device
assert_script_run "sed -i -e 's|^NETCONFIG_DNS_STATIC_SERVERS=.*|NETCONFIG_DNS_STATIC_SERVERS=\"$servers\"|' /etc/sysconfig/network/config";
assert_script_run "netconfig -f update";
}
}
sub parse_network_configuration {
my @networks = ('fixed');
@networks = split /\s*,\s*/, get_var("NETWORKS") if get_var("NETWORKS");
my @mac = split /\s*,\s*/, get_var("NICMAC");
my $net_conf = {};
for (my $i = 0; $networks[$i]; $i++) {
my $network = $networks[$i];
$net_conf->{$network} = {
mac => $mac[$i],
num => $i,
};
}
for (my $i = 0; $i < 10; $i++) {
my $conf = get_var("NETWORK$i");
if ($conf) {
my ($network, @param) = split /\s*,\s*/, $conf;
if (!defined $net_conf->{$network}) {
print "unknown network $network\n";
next;
}
for my $p (@param) {
my ($name, $val) = split /=/, $p;
$net_conf->{$network}->{$name} = $val;
}
}
}
$net_conf->{fixed} //= {};
$net_conf->{fixed}->{subnet} = '10.0.2.0/24';
$net_conf->{fixed}->{dhcp} = 'yes';
$net_conf->{fixed}->{gateway} = '10.0.2.2';
for my $net (values %$net_conf) {
if ($net->{subnet}) {
my ($ip, $mask) = split /\//, $net->{subnet};
$net->{subnet_ip} = $ip;
if ($mask =~ /^\d+$/) {
my $n = 0xffffffff << (32 - $mask);
my $n4 = $n % 256;
$n /= 256;
my $n3 = $n % 256;
$n /= 256;
my $n2 = $n % 256;
$n /= 256;
my $n1 = $n % 256;
$mask = "$n1.$n2.$n3.$n4";
}
$net->{subnet_mask} = $mask;
}
}
return $net_conf;
}
sub ip_in_subnet {
my ($network, $num) = @_;
my ($i1, $i2, $i3, $i4) = split /\./, $network->{subnet_ip};
my $ip = ((($i1 * 256) + $i2) * 256 + $i3) * 256 + $i4 + $num;
my $n4 = $ip % 256;
$ip /= 256;
my $n3 = $ip % 256;
$ip /= 256;
my $n2 = $ip % 256;
$ip /= 256;
my $n1 = $ip % 256;
return join '.', ($n1, $n2, $n3, $n4);
}
sub check_ip_in_subnet {
my ($network, $ip) = @_;
my ($i1, $i2, $i3, $i4) = split /\./, $network->{subnet_ip};
my $subnet_ip = ((($i1 * 256) + $i2) * 256 + $i3) * 256 + $i4;
($i1, $i2, $i3, $i4) = split /\./, $network->{subnet_mask};
my $mask_ip = ((($i1 * 256) + $i2) * 256 + $i3) * 256 + $i4;
($i1, $i2, $i3, $i4) = split /\./, $ip;
my $check_ip = ((($i1 * 256) + $i2) * 256 + $i3) * 256 + $i4;
return ($check_ip & $mask_ip) == ($subnet_ip & $mask_ip);
}
sub setup_static_mm_network {
my $ip = shift;
my $is_nm = is_networkmanager();
configure_static_ip(ip => $ip, is_nm => $is_nm);
configure_default_gateway(is_nm => $is_nm);
configure_static_dns(get_host_resolv_conf(), is_nm => $is_nm);
restart_networking(is_nm => $is_nm);
}
sub restart_networking {
my (%args) = @_;
my $is_nm = $args{is_nm} // is_networkmanager();
if ($is_nm) {
assert_script_run 'nmcli networking off';
assert_script_run 'nmcli networking on';
# Wait until the connections are configured
my $expected_nm_connectivity = get_var('EXPECTED_NM_CONNECTIVITY', 'full');
if ($expected_nm_connectivity ne 'none') {
assert_script_run "timeout 90 bash -c \"until nmcli networking connectivity check | tee /dev/stderr | grep -E '$expected_nm_connectivity'; do sleep 10; done\"";
}
} else {
assert_script_run 'rcnetwork restart';
}
record_info('network cfg', script_output('ip address show; echo; ip route show; echo; grep -v "^#" /etc/resolv.conf', proceed_on_failure => 1));
}
1;
